Minnesota

Minnesota is a state located in the midwestern United States. As a state, it ranks twelve for area and twenty-one for population. It is known as the "Land of 10,000 Lakes" and "The Gopher State." Minnesota is home to thirty-three of the top 1,000 publicly-traded companies in the United States.

When was Minnesota's current constitution adopted?

The Minnesota constitution was initially approved on October 13, 1857 and ratified by the US Senate on May 11, 1858. It was modified on November 5, 1974, to make it easier to reference and understand.

Witch state has the larger land area Minnesota or Iowa?

Minnesota. Minnesota (79,610 square miles) vs. Iowa (55,869 square miles)

Where would you find oak trees in minnesota?

In Minnesota, oak trees are primarily found in the southeastern part of the state, where the climate and soil conditions are more favorable. They thrive in well-drained soils and are often seen in forests, savannas, and along the edges of fields. Common species include the Northern Red Oak and Bur Oak. Additionally, oak trees may be planted in urban areas and parks throughout the state.
